Questionnaires don't put any pressure on the person who answers them, especially questionnaires not directed at any specific user. If you're not singling anybody out and telling them to take the questionnaire, it's almost entirely useless.
Questionnaires are good in games where there are a lot of newer users, as simply voting for random people and then asking and answering seemingly random questions based solely off of either a dumb voting decision or a tone of voice is going to leave a good bit of people isolated. Asking questions that at least have some relevance to the game allows for these players to have something to say. This then allows for us to ask these users follow-up questions and start to get reads on them. Newer users from my experience are much more reluctant to post much of anything, which always leads to the same questions like "why aren't you saying anything," or "what do you think of x user" (to which the answer is usually "i don't know").

The problem with most questionnaires is that it's stupid shit like

>How many mafia do you think there are
>Who do you think is scum
>Who do you think is town

where most of the things are either irrelevant to the game but to the inexperienced can appear relevant. Think: do I care how many mafia there are when mylo/lylo is announced? No. Heck, I barely care when it isn't announced.
